On March 29,
Queen Máxima
opened the 51st Spring Conference of the Netherlands Society of Psychiatry (Nederlandse Vereniging voor Psychiatrie NVvP), which took place at the Maastricht Exhibition and Congress Centre.
Her Majesty gave a speech at the event and also showed off her new look.
This time, the queen chose a dark blue dress from the American brand Oscar de la Renta.
The outfit had long sleeves and an A-line style.
The Oscar de la Renta brand is distinguished by the fact that it uses floral prints and embroidery in most of its designs, so the Queen's dress was no exception - Maxima's outfit had large white flowers that gave the dress elegance.
Queen Maxima / Photo: Getty Images
The queen completed the look with a navy hat with a wide brim from Maison Fabienne Delvigne and pumps from Gianvito Rossi, one of her favorite brands.
A clutch and jewelry with blue stones completed this ensemble.
